1.A Study on the Effects and Mechanism of Arsenic Trioxide in Inducing Apoptosis of Colonic Cancer Cell Line
Junqing LUO ; Qiwen XU ; Zhenliang WANG
Journal of Chinese Physician 2001;0(10):-
Objective To explore the effects and molecular mechanisms of arsenic trioxide(As 2O 3) in inducing apoptosis of colonic cancer cell line SW480. Methods The morphologic changes and apoptotic rate of SW480 cells induced by As 2O 3 were observed with fluorescent microscopy and flow cytometry. The bcl-2 and Fas expressions induced by As 2O 3 in SW480 cells were examined by immunohistochemical method. Results 24 hours after exposed to As 2O 3, SW480 cells exhibited typical morphologic changes of apoptosis, the apoptotic rate of which was 2.1%~10.6%. A typical subdiploid peak before G 1 phase was observed by flow cytometry, and As 2O 3 mainly acted in G 2/M phase. As 2O 3 decreased bcl-2 expression and increased Fas expression in SW480 cells. Conclusion As 2O 3 could induce apoptosis of SW480 cells. The molecular mechanism of As 2O 3-induced apoptosis of SW480 cells might be down-regulating the bcl-2 expression and up-regulating the Fas expression.

3.Protective Effects of ?-asarone against Myocardial Ischemia/Reperfusion Injury in Cultured Cardiac Myocytes
Qiwen WANG ; Qiduan WU ; Yizhi CHEN
Chinese Journal of Information on Traditional Chinese Medicine 2006;0(12):-
Objective To study the protective effects of ?-asarone against the myocardial ischemia/ reperfusion injury (MI/RI) in cultured cardiac myocytes. Methods MI/RI model was set up with Na2S2O4, which make use of rat cardiac myocytes. The viability of cardiac myocytes (using MTT method), dehydrogenase (LDH, CK) activitices in the medium were measured. Results In MI/RI model, ?-asarone can obviously advance the viability of cardiac myocytes, and decrease the dehydrogenase (LDH, CK) activitices in the medium. Conclusion ?-asarone showed protective effects against the myocardial ischemia/reperfusion injury in cultured cardiac myocytes.
4.Investigation of psychological status of the AIDS affected orphans settled in Sunshine Homestead
Qiwen XIE ; Fei WANG ; Jiakun LU
Chinese Journal of AIDS & STD 2007;0(03):-
Objective To understand the psychological status of the AIDS affected orphans in Henan Sunshine Homestead.Methods One hundred orphans from three Henan Sunshine Homesteads were investigated by questionnaire and depth-interviews.Results The study showed that the AIDS affected orphans were satisfied with their present living conditions in general,but still had some dissatisfaction.They valued peer relations,but were passive to contact strangers,and also felt lacking of care from the elderly.Nearly 70% of the orphans were some what introverted in nature,and some were in lack of thankful heart to managers of the Homestead and their patrons.
5.In vitro activity of ciprofloxacin or Amikacin combined with ?-lactams against Multidrug-Resistant Pseudomonas aeruginosa Strains
Qiwen YANG ; Hui WANG ; Yingchun XU
Chinese Journal of Practical Internal Medicine 2001;0(09):-
Objective The aim of this study was to evaluate the in vitro activity of Ciprofloxacin(CIP)or Amikacin(AK)combined with four clinically-used antipseudomonas ?-lactams against multidrug-resistant Pseudomonas aeruginosa strains.Methods Determining the MICs of six antibiotics to 35 clinically isolated Pseudomonas aeruginosa strains which have different resistance patterns by 2-fold broth dilution method;determining the in vitro activity of Ciprofloxacin or Amikacin combined with Ceftazidime(CAZ),Imipenem(IMP),Meropenem(MEM)and Piperacillin/Tazobactam(TZP)by broth checkerboard method.Results The combinations of Ciprofloxacin or Amikacin with four ?-lactams have mainly synergistic or additive effect,the synergistic rate of AK-group(AK+CAZ:71.43%;AK+IMP:42.86%;AK+MEM:54.29%;AK+TZP:85.71%)was higher than that of CIP-group(CIP+CAZ:20%;CIP+IMP:25.71%;CIP+MEM:14.29%;CIP+TZP:31.43%).The combination of CIP+TZP has the highest synergistic rate in CIP-group;the combination of AK+TZP has the highest synergistic rate in AK-group.None of the combinations had an antagonistic effect.Conclusion the combination of ciprofloxacin or amikacin with ?-lactams have good in vitro activity to multidrug-resistant Pseudomonas aeruginosa strains.
6.Extraction of Volatile Oil from Naokangling Capsule and Processing Techniques of Its p-cyclodextrin Inclusion Compound
Yan WANG ; Liling ZHOU ; Mudan ZHANG ; Qiwen WANG
Journal of Guangzhou University of Traditional Chinese Medicine 1999;0(02):-
[Objective] To screen an optimal method for the extraction of volatile oil from Naokangling Capsule (NC) and processing techniques of ?-cyclodextrin (?-CD) inclusion compound of NC. [Methods] The study was carried out with orthogonal design . Oil-extraction ratio, oil-bearing rate and inclusion rate of ?-CD inclusion compound of NC were used as indexes. [Results] The optimal process for oil extraction was adding 10-fold water in medicinal materials and then soaking for one hour and distilling for 5 hours. The optimal processing conditions for ?-CD inclusion compound of NC were: the proportion of ?-CD and volatile oil being 6:1, the inclusion compound being stirred for 2 hours at 40℃ . [Conclusion] This method is simple and practical and can increase the stability of preprations. It can be used for the production of ?-CD inclusion compound in a large scale.
7.Chemical constituents from Securidaca inappendiculata
Qiwen WANG ; Dongdong CHEN ; Chengyao MA ; Xiang LI ; Jianwei CHEN
Chinese Traditional Patent Medicine 2017;39(6):1199-1203
AIM To study the chemical constituents from Securidaca inappendiculata Hassk..METHODS The dichloromethane and ethyl acetate fractions of S.inappendiculata 95% ethanol extract were isolated and purified by silica,gel column and recrystallization,then the structures of obtained compounds were identified by physicochemical properties and spectral data.RESULTS Ten compounds were isolated and identified as 8-hydroxy-1,3,4-trimethoxyxanthone (1),1,2,7-trimethoxyxanth-one (2),4-hydroxy-3,5-dimethoxybenzaldehyde (3),sesamin (4),2-methoxy-3,4-methylenedioxybenzophenone (5),1,3,7-trihydroxy-4-methoxyxanthone (6),1,3,7-t-rihydroxy-2-methoxyxanthone (7),2-hydroxy-1,7-dimethoxyxanthone (8),3,8-dih-ydroxy-1,4-dimethoxyxanthone (9),oα-spinasterol (10).CONCLUSION Compound 1 is first found in the form of natural product,compounds 2-4 are isolated from genus Securidaca for the first time.
8.Transfected thymidine phosphorylase cDNA with lentiviral vector and INF-α2a enhance the anticancer effects of 5'-deoxy-5-fluorouridine on colorectal cancer cell line LOVO
Qi LIU ; Qiwen WANG ; Jimin ZHANG ; Geng FANG
Chinese Journal of General Surgery 2015;30(5):386-390
Objective Thymidine phosphorylase (TP) cDNA was transfected into colorectal cancer cell lines LOVO with the lentiviral vector,the anticancer effeciency of 5'-deoxy-5-fluorouridine (5'-DFUR)and 5-fluorouracil (5-FU) on LOVO cells were evaluated.Methods TP cDNA were transfected into LOVO cell line with the lentiviral vector pLenti6.3_MCS_IRES2-EGFP,and the transfection efficiency was analyzed by flow cytometer and immunohistochemistry.Cells were divided into six groups:LOVO,LOVO-TP,LOVO-control,LOVO + INF-α2a,LOVO-TP + INF-α2a,LOVO-control + INF-α2a.TP protein expression and the relative quantitative analysis for TP mRNA in transfections cells were detected by Western blot and RT-PCR respectively.Volumes of converted 5-FU from either in the medium containing different concentration of 5'-DFUR,in which all cells were cultured,or in cells lysate,were detected by high performance liquid chromatography (HPLC).Results The transfection efficiency of TP cDNA in LOVO cells was 95%.The Mean gray value of TP protein expression in LOVO-TP and LOVO-TP + INF-α2a were 198.15 folds and 243.22 folds higher than LOVO cell,respectively (P < 0.01).The RQ values of TP mRNA expression in LOVO-TP and LOVO-TP + INF-α2a were also 18.56 folds and 59.61 folds higher than wild LOVO cell,respectively (P < 0.01).The IC50 values of 5'-DFUR on LOVO-TP and LOVO-TP + INF-α2a were 1 660 μ mol/L and 813 μ mol/L,respectively,significantly lower than 4 462.59 μ mol/L in wild LOVO (P < O.01).The 5-FU volumes detected from media contained series concentration of 5'-DFUR for culturing LOVO-TP and LOVO-TP + INF-α2a were 2.0-5.3 folds,and 2.9-10.4 folds more than wild LOVO,respectively (P < 0.01).Conclusions Transfected TP cDNA into colorectal cancer cell line LOVO with lentiviral vector increases the expression of TP mRNA and TP protein and the amount of 5-FU converted from 5'-DFUR,enhancing its anticancer effect.
9.Evaluation of quality of life in patients aged 70 years and over following off-pump coronary artery bypass grafting
Tiefu ZHAO ; Shengyu WANG ; Qiwen ZHOU ; Hanying MA
Chinese Journal of Geriatrics 2010;29(10):818-820
Objective To evaluate the quality of life status in patients aged 70 years and over following off-pump coronary artery bypass (OPCAB) grafting. Methods Seventy-eight patients with coronary heart disease [mean age (74.6 ± 5.3) years, 66 males, 12 females] were investigated retrospectively. Three questionnaires about the quality of life, including Seattle Angina Questionnaire (SAQ), Nottingham Healthy Profile (Part Ⅰ NHP) and Duke Activity Status Index (DASD, were used to investigate patients before and after OPCAB. Results Prior to OPCAB, there was lower quality of life index in males than in females [SAQ: (65.3±5.1) vs. (69.5±8.1); NHP: (89.4±17.3) vs. (125.2±19.9), P<0.01; DASI: (4. 1±1.1) vs. (4.3± 1.3)]. At the 12th months after OPCABG, there were significant improvements in all patients. The effects were less pronounced in females than in males [SAQ: (83.1 ±5.8) vs. (88.5±4.5), P<0.05; NHP: (84.7± 11.7) vs.(91.4±13.7), P<0.05; DASI: (4.7±1.4) vs. (5.4±1.1)]. Conclusions Our study shows that OPCAB improves quality of life in elderly patients with coronary heart disease. The benefits of OPCAB are even more pronounced in male patients.
10.Application of Microwave Technology in the Preparation of Plastic Beads
Yifan CHENG ; Hong GOU ; Qiwen TAN ; Bing WANG ; Su WU
China Pharmacy 2005;0(15):-
OBJECTIVE:To study the advantage of microwave technology in the preparation of plastic beads. METHODS:Three kinds of representative processing methods were applied to prepare Equus asinus,Colla Cornus Cervi and Colla Carapax et Plastri Testudinis. The processing methods and the quality of plastic beads were compared. RESULTS:Study results showed mic-rowave technology was superior to other processing methods in the preparation of plastic beads and quality. CONCLUSION:The microwave technology has its specific advantages in the preparation of plastic beads.
